PacSun returning to Montgomery Mall in Bethesda


When I reported nearly a year ago that PacSun would be returning to Westfield Montgomery Mall, there were some doubting Thomases who could not believe it. After all, the California-inspired surf and skate-wear retailer had just closed at the mall two years earlier. But PacSun has now made its return to the popular retail center official with coming-soon signage. PacSun will be located between Carter's and T-Mobile on Level 1 of the Old Navy/Cheesecake Factory wing.
